Zeochem is seeking a Wastewater Utility Operator in Louisville, KY. The role monitors all on-site utility systems to support manufacturing and requires knowledge of pH controls, chemical handling, and routine maintenance.
The ideal candidate has experience with caustics/acids, mechanical troubleshooting, and control systems, and must pass a pre-employment check. Full-time with on-site duties and shift coverage are included.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S
While performing the duties of this job , the employee is regularly required to use hands to finger, handle, or feel; reach with hands and arms; and talk or hear. The employee frequently is required to stand; walk; and st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l. The employee must bend and twist on a regular basis. The employee is occasionally required to sit and climb or balance. The employee must regularly lift and/or move up to 50 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, depth perception, and ability to adjust focus. Frequently required to walk upstairs and or steps.
WORK ENVIRONMENT
The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ly exposed to moving mechanical parts. The employee is frequently exposed to fumes or airborne particles and extreme heat. The employee is occasionally exposed to high, precarious places; caustic chemicals; outside weather conditions; risk of electrical shock; and vibration.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
